AI-Integrated Wallets Transform User Experience

AI-integrated wallets are emerging as a cornerstone of this transformative shift, promising a superior user experience characterized by heightened accessibility, enhanced security, and expanded functionality.These wallets leverage advanced AI algorithms to streamline various processes, ensuring that users can navigate the DeFi landscape with ease and confidence. Through the use of machine learning and predictive analytics, AI-integrated wallets can offer personalized services that adapt to individual user needs, making financial management more intuitive and responsive.One notable development in this field is the launch of the first AI-enhanced wallet by DeFi-AI. This milestone represents a significant leap forward, as the wallet’s AI capabilities enable it to provide real-time financial insights, automated transaction processing, and intelligent investment advice.Users can benefit from a more tailored and efficient financial experience, as the wallet dynamically adjusts to market conditions and user behavior. Enhanced security measures, such as biometric authentication and anomaly detection, further ensure that users’ assets are protected from potential threats.As AI technology continues to evolve, the potential applications of AI-integrated wallets are vast. From predictive financial planning to automated portfolio management, these wallets are set to become indispensable tools for both novice and experienced users. By bridging the gap between traditional finance and the emerging DeFi ecosystem, AI-integrated wallets are paving the way for a more inclusive and accessible financial future.

Real Business Asset Tokenization: A New Frontier

The concept of Real Business Asset Tokenization (RBA) is another pivotal advancement in the DeFi space, facilitating the digital representation of tangible assets such as properties, stocks, and artworks on the blockchain. This innovation not only enhances liquidity and global accessibility but also opens up unprecedented opportunities for portfolio diversification. By converting real-world assets into digital tokens, RBA tokenization allows for fractional ownership, enabling investors to access a wider range of assets with smaller capital outlays.RBA tokenization is particularly noteworthy for its potential to democratize investment opportunities. By lowering the barriers to entry, it enables a broader audience to participate in asset markets that were previously reserved for institutional investors and high-net-worth individuals. This democratization fosters greater financial inclusion, as individuals from diverse economic backgrounds can now invest in a variety of asset classes and benefit from their potential returns.

Furthermore, RBA tokenization brings transparency and efficiency to asset transactions.Utilizing blockchain technology ensures that all transactions are recorded on an immutable ledger, reducing the risk of fraud and enhancing trust among participants. Additionally, the automation of smart contracts streamlines the execution of complex financial agreements, minimizing the need for intermediaries and reducing transaction costs. As the adoption of RBA tokenization continues to expand, it is poised to revolutionize industries ranging from real estate to fine arts, creating a more dynamic and interconnected global economy.
